shutdown(2)							   shutdown(2)

Name
       shutdown - shut down full-duplex connection

Syntax
       shutdown(s, how)
       int s, how;

Description
       The  call  causes all or part of a full-duplex connection on the socket
       associated with s to be shut down.  If how is 0, further	 receives  are
       disallowed.   If	 how is 1, further sends are disallowed.  If how is 2,
       further sends and receives are disallowed.

Return Values
       A zero (0) is returned if the call succeeds, -1 if it fails.

Diagnostics
       The call succeeds unless:

       [EBADF]	      The s argument is not a valid descriptor.

       [ENOTSOCK]     The s argument is a file, not a socket.

       [ENOTCONN]     The specified socket is not connected.

See Also
       connect(2), socket(2)
